Definition of Weeds and Invasive Species π±
Weeds are those pesky plants that pop up in cultivated areas, often competing with your prized flowers or vegetables for sunlight, water, and nutrients. On the other hand, invasive species are non-native plants that can spread like wildfire, wreaking havoc on local ecosystems, economies, and even human health.
Criteria for Classifying as Invasive π«
To be classified as invasive, a plant must exhibit a few key traits. First, it should have a rapid spread, often producing thousands of seeds that can easily take root.
Next, its competitive nature allows it to form dense thickets, outcompeting native vegetation for resources. Lastly, invasive species significantly alter habitats, disrupting local ecosystems and diminishing biodiversity.

Identification
Key Identifying Features π
Red Twig Dogwood 'Arctic Fire' typically grows between 3 to 9 feet tall. Its most striking feature is the bright red stems, especially vibrant during winter months.
The leaves are opposite and ovate, showcasing a lush green in summer that transitions to a warm yellow in fall. In late spring, small white clusters of flowers appear, later giving way to white berries.
Comparison with Look-Alike Plants π
When identifying Red Twig Dogwood, it's essential to distinguish it from similar species like Flowering Dogwood and Pagoda Dogwood.
Key differences include leaf arrangement, flower structure, and, notably, stem color. Flowering Dogwood has a more rounded shape and distinct flower bracts, while Pagoda Dogwood features a more layered branching pattern. Growth Habits and Spread
Typical Growth Patterns π±
Red Twig Dogwood 'Arctic Fire' is known for its rapid growth, often reaching heights of 3 to 9 feet within a single growing season. This vigorous growth allows it to quickly dominate its surroundings.
Form and Spread π³
The plant spreads primarily through suckering, which means it can create dense thickets that crowd out other vegetation. This ability to form thick stands makes it particularly challenging to manage in cultivated areas.
Reproductive Strategies πΌ
One of the most concerning aspects of Red Twig Dogwood is its prolific seed production. Each plant can produce thousands of seeds annually, significantly increasing its chances of spreading.
Vegetative Reproduction πΏ
In addition to seeds, the plant can reproduce vegetatively. Suckers can root and establish new plants, further contributing to its invasive nature and making control efforts more difficult.

Control and Management
π± Manual Removal Techniques
Identifying infested areas is the first step. Regular monitoring allows for early detection, making it easier to manage the spread of Red Twig Dogwood 'Arctic Fire'.
For small plants, hand-pulling is effective. Ensure you uproot the entire root system to prevent regrowth.
For larger plants, cutting is necessary. Cut the stems at ground level and make sure to remove all debris to minimize the chance of re-establishment.
π§ͺ Chemical Control Options
Herbicides can be a powerful tool in managing invasive species. Glyphosate or triclopyr are commonly used, but always follow label instructions for safe application.
Timing is crucial. Apply these chemicals in late summer or early fall when the plants are actively growing for the best results.
π¦ Biological Control Methods
Research is ongoing into biological control methods. Introducing natural predators could provide a sustainable solution to managing Red Twig Dogwood 'Arctic Fire'.
π« Preventive Measures
Preventive measures are key to controlling this invasive species. Regular monitoring helps ensure early detection and a rapid response to new growth.
Mulching is another effective strategy. Using landscape fabric or mulch can suppress growth in affected areas, reducing the likelihood of re-infestation.
